Albert Borris (Washington D.C./ Massachusetts, IXX-XX Century) was born in Eastern Prussia, Borris studied at the academies in Konigsberg, Berline, and Dusseldorf. He immigrated to the United States in 1881, first living in Washington, D. C., before moving to the Boston area. The painting we have here is a watercolor on paper. it depicts a man on a hay cart being drawn by a pair of horses. The cart meanders down a dirt road, fall foliage with a post and rail fence can be seen in the landscape. The painting is signed lower right «A. Borris», it is housed in a simple gilt wood molding frame with caramel colored mat with protective glass front. Measures; sight size 9 1/2″ x 5 3/4″, framed 17″ x 13″ .
